Monoclonal Antibodies to Human Glomerular Cells: A Marker for Glomerular Epithelial Cells

摘要:

A monoclonal antibody, PHM 5, directed against human glomerular epithelial cells, was prepared after immunisation of a mouse with isolated human glomeruli and fusion of spleen cells with a mouse myeloma. Binding of antibody to isolated glomeruli was detected by radioimmune indirect binding assay, and specificity for glomerular epithelial cells was shown using a four-layer peroxidase-antiperoxidase technique applied to epoxy resin sections of the human kidney cortex. PHM 5 appears to detect a human-specific cell surface carbohydrate antigen not previously described, and can be used to identify epithelial cells in renal biopsy sections and in culture outgrowths of isolated glomeruli.
